From prehistoric times, Egyptians probably used the power of the annual flooding of the Nile to irrigate their lands, steadily studying to regulate much of it through purposely constructed irrigation channels and “catch” basins. The historical Sumerians in Mesopotamia used a complex system of canals and levees to divert water from the Tigris and Euphrates rivers for irrigation. Continuing improvements led to the furnace and bellows and offered, for the first time, the power to smelt and forge gold, copper, silver, and lead – native metals present in comparatively pure type in nature. The benefits of copper tools over stone, bone and wood instruments had been rapidly obvious to early humans, and native copper was most likely used from close to the start of Neolithic times .
